[QUOTE="ppro, post: 28647, member: 826"] 6brguy My wife has used her 6.5 x 55 for everything from Antelope to Moose with good effect. Bullet used was the 140 Nosler partition and the bullet performed very well. This bullet is capable of rear end shots that make it into the boiler room of Moose so I know penetration is very good as is killing effect. This is from the 6.5 x 55 loaded to pressures for todays guns, not the older 6.5 x 55 gun velocities. I personally would not choose a bullet except one that will not break totally up on heavy bone of shoulders and hips which leaves you with a few good choices, among which is the Nosler partition....which has been very accurate in all the calibers I have used over the years.
